Job description

LS GreenLink is building a new, state-of-the-art manufacturing facilityto produce high-voltage submarine power cablesin Chesapeake, VA.These cables are integral to the global supply chain for offshore wind farms and designed to optimize bulk clean-power transmission. This operation will generate a variety of professional and production positionsand help bring advanced manufacturing capabilities to support the clean technology industry in Virginia... andyou can be a part of it!

We areseekinga highly organized and proactiveProject Coordination Manager to oversee construction administration and external relations for our new manufacturing facility project. This role serves as the primary bridge between our organization, local government authorities, utility providers, and community stakeholders, ensuring seamless compliance, permitting, and relationship management throughout the project lifecycle.
